From: VEGFR2 promotes tumorigenesis and metastasis in a pro-angiogenic-independent way in gastric cancer

Fig. 5

The effect of VEGFR2 on VTN expression. a & b Real-time PCR and Western blot analysis of relative levels of VTN in MKN-45 cells after VEGFR2 knockdown. c & d Real-time PCR and Western blot analysis of relative levels of VTN in SCH cells after VEGFR2 overexpression. e & f Real-time PCR and Western blot analysis of relative levels of VTN in a panel of gastric cancer cell lines and immortalized normal human gastric mucosal epithelial cell line GES-1. g & h IHC staining analysis of VTN in MKN-45 xenograft tumors. i & j IHC staining analysis of VTN in SCH xenograft tumors. k Representative images of anti-VTN staining in human gastric cancer tissues. l Relationship between expressions of VEGFR2 and VTN in human gastric cancer tissues. **P < 0.01, significant differences vs. the respective control groups
